.NET Developer (Security-Focused) || Chicago, IL

  • Chicago, IL
  • Posted 3 days ago | Updated 3 days ago

Overview

Hybrid
$50 - $60
Full Time

Skills

.NET
ASP.NET
Software Security
Amazon Web Services
Cloud Security
GraphQL
Problem Solving
Security QA

Job Details

.NET Developer (Security-Focused) || Chicago, IL ||

Job Title: .NET Developer (Security-Focused)
Location: Chicago, IL
Work Mode: Hybrid (1 Day/Week)

Top 5 Skills:

  • Expertise in .NET technologies (C#, ASP.NET, .NET Core) with a strong focus on secure coding practices.
  • Proficiency in Identity and Access Management (IAM), including OAuth2.0, OpenID Connect, and Active Directory/ADFS.
  • Hands-on experience with application security controls such as authentication, authorization, and encryption.
  • Strong knowledge of OWASP Top 10 vulnerabilities and mitigation strategies.
  • Familiarity with DevSecOps practices and integration of security tools into CI/CD pipelines.

Responsibilities:

  • Design, develop, and maintain secure .NET applications ensuring compliance with industry security standards.
  • Implement robust authentication and authorization mechanisms using OAuth2.0, OpenID Connect, and Active Directory.
  • Conduct secure code reviews, threat modeling, and vulnerability assessments for .NET applications.
  • Collaborate with DevOps teams to integrate security testing tools (SAST, DAST, SCA) into CI/CD pipelines.
  • Ensure data protection and encryption for sensitive information in transit and at rest.
  • Monitor, detect, and remediate potential security vulnerabilities in applications.
  • Partner with cross-functional teams to drive a security-first culture in software development.

Required Qualifications:

  • Proven experience as a .NET Developer with strong emphasis on application and cloud security.
  • Proficiency in C#, ASP.NET, .NET Core, and secure coding practices.
  • Solid understanding of web security standards (OWASP, NIST).
  • Hands-on experience implementing OAuth2.0, OpenID Connect, SAML, JWT, and Role-Based Access Control (RBAC).
  • Experience with secure API development (REST/GraphQL) including token-based authentication.
  • Familiarity with container security (Docker, Kubernetes) and cloud security controls (Azure/AWS).
  • Knowledge of cryptography standards (TLS, HTTPS, PKI, hashing algorithms).
  • Strong debugging, problem-solving, and incident response skills with a security-first mindset.
  • Excellent communication and collaboration skills; ability to explain security risks to non-technical stakeholders.
  • Experience working in Agile/Scrum development environments.

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.